Estimated Monthly Heating Costs by Climate Zone
Costs vary by region, with colder zones paying more in winter months. In the South, monthly heating bills are typically lower, often $60–$140 during peak season for homes with mild winters. In the Midwest and Northeast, expect higher ranges, commonly $120–$350 per month when temperatures stay near freezing for long periods. In coastal and southwest areas with milder winters, bills can stay under $100–$150 per month during shoulder seasons. These figures assume normal occupancy and standard maintenance.
Key Price Drivers: System Type, Efficiency, and Fuel
System type and energy source are the largest cost levers for monthly heating. A gas furnace with high-efficiency ratings (95%+ AFUE) can reduce monthly energy costs compared with older 70–80% AFUE units. Electric resistance heating (baseboard or electric furnaces) typically costs more per month in colder climates, due to higher per-kWh rates and greater consumption. Heat pumps can lower bills in milder winters but may climb in cold snaps unless paired with auxiliary heating. Typical ranges by system type: gas furnace lows around $80–$140, averages $140–$260, highs $260–$350; electric heat $120–$260 on average; heat pumps $180–$320 on average depending on climate and efficiency. Assumptions: standard size home, moderate to good insulation, regular thermostat programming.

Strong Variables That Change the Final Quote
Two numeric thresholds frequently shift monthly heating costs: home size and climate severity. A home larger than 2,000 sq ft tends to push baseline heating consumption higher, especially in gas or electric resistance systems. Climate severity measured by average winter heating degree days (HDD) dramatically alters monthly bills; a climate with 4,000 HDD will run hotter bills than a region with 1,500 HDD even for similar homes. Additional drivers include insulation quality, air leakage, and the presence of heat pumps with auxiliary heat. Assumptions: typical single-family homes, standard ductwork, measured HDD ranges by region.

Seasonal Variations and Timing for Pricing
Monthly costs peak in the coldest months, often December through February. In many regions, heating costs rise 20–40% during cold snaps compared with mild weeks. Early-season prevention, such as sealing leaks and servicing equipment before demand spikes, can stabilize monthly charges. Conversely, sudden cold fronts or fuel price spikes can push bills up quickly. A prudent plan includes monitoring thermostat performance and pre-winter service. Ways to Lower Your Heating Bill This Winter
Strategic choices reduce monthly costs without sacrificing comfort. Start with sealing air leaks around doors, windows, and attic access; improve insulation where practical; install a programmable or smart thermostat to optimize runtime; consider a higher-efficiency furnace or heat pump if the current setup is older than 15 years. Simple steps like lowering the setpoint by 2–3 degrees during the day, and by 5–7 degrees at night when occupants are asleep, can yield meaningful savings over the season. If replacement is necessary, compare bids not just on price but on efficiency, warranty, and expected annual energy savings. What a Typical Month Looks Like by System Type
Monthly bills vary by system type, even with similar homes. A gas furnace with high AFUE (95%+) in a moderate climate may cost $120–$260 per month in winter. A mid-range electric furnace can range $180–$300. A heat pump in a cold climate with auxiliary heat might sit around $200–$320, while in milder areas it could fall to $120–$260. In all cases, efficiency, duct health, and thermostat behavior drive the final amount. Assumptions: standard maintenance, typical occupancy, regional energy pricing.
